PdCl2(CH3CN)2-catalyzed regioselective C-H olefinations of 2-amino biaryls with vinylsilanes as unactivated alkenes

The first example of palladium-catalyzed chelation-assisted C-H olefination of 2-amino biaryls using readily available vinylsilanes as unactivated olefinating reagents has been developed, affording valuable arylated vinylsilane compounds in moderate to excellent yields and with exclusive (E)-selectivities.
REARRANGEMENT OF 2-HETARYLALKYLPYRIDINIUM SALTS

The rearrangement of 2-thienyl- and 2-furylalkylpyridinium salts to the corresponding anilines by the action of methylammonium sulfites has been studied.It has been shown that the rearrangement of these salts is accompanied in many cases by the formation of phenols and dealkylation products.The influence of the length of the alkyl chain between the heterocyclic rings on the ratio of the rearrangement products has been investigated.
